Glass Butterfly Elegance
Wow Amazing Insects
Wow Amazing Insects
Malayan leaf frog
can you see it
Glass Butterfly Elegance
can you see it
Wow Amazing Insects
Wow Amazing Insects
Learn about Sea Sheep! The cutest animal you have never heard of!
Malayan leaf frog
Malayan leaf frog
The unexpected sound of this katydid
Wow Amazing Insects